M444 JVO is a 2008 Jeep Wrangler Sahara Unlimited in Green with a 2,777c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 88.2%.
Across all 2008 Jeep Wrangler Sahara Unlimited models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.6% with a typical mileage of 80,149 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Jeep Wrangler Sahara Unlimited fails its MOT is position lamp(s) not working, accounting for 82 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M444 JVO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Jeep Wrangler Sahara Unlimited typ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 18 years old, this Jeep Wrangler Sahara Unlimited is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
